Understanding FSGS
FSGS is a pattern of injury, not a single disease. Under the microscope, parts (segmental) of some (focal) glomeruli show scarring. Caused by damage to podocytes — the specialised cells that form the kidney's filter barrier.
FINDING THE CAUSE matters more than the biopsy pattern:
1. PRIMARY (idiopathic) FSGS:
- Driven by a circulating 'permeability factor' (target of research)
- Sudden-onset nephrotic syndrome
- Diffuse podocyte foot process effacement on electron microscopy
- May respond to steroids
2. Genetic FSGS
- Mutations in podocyte genes: NPHS1 (nephrin), NPHS2 (podocin), INF2, ACTN4, COL4A3/4/5, APOL1 (in African ancestry)
- Often childhood onset but adult presentations exist
- Does NOT respond to immunosuppression — important to identify
- Genetic counselling for family
3. SECONDARY FSGS (adaptive or maladaptive):
- Obesity (BMI > 35)
- Solitary kidney, reflux nephropathy, low birth weight (reduced nephron number)
- Sickle cell disease
- HIV-associated nephropathy (HIVAN)
- Heroin, anabolic steroids, lithium, pamidronate, interferon
- Healed previous injury (post-AKI, post-ANCA vasculitis)
- Slower onset, less heavy proteinuria, lower albumin drop
4. Apol1-mediated
- High-risk APOL1 variants (G1, G2) in African ancestry — major US/UK problem
- Drug trials with APOL1 inhibitors are advancing
Symptoms and diagnosis
Typical FSGS Presentations
- Frothy urine
- Ankle and leg swelling (oedema)
- Periorbital puffiness in mornings
- Weight gain from fluid
- Sometimes acute kidney injury
- Sometimes asymptomatic proteinuria found on routine dip
Investigations
- Urine ACR (often very high, > 300, sometimes > 1,000)
- Serum albumin (low — nephrotic if < 30 g/L)
- Cholesterol (typically very high)
- eGFR / creatinine
- HIV, hepatitis B/C, syphilis serology
- ANA, ANCA, complement
- Sickle solubility (if relevant)
- Genetic panel — especially if young, family history, or no clear secondary cause
- KIDNEY BIOPSY — diagnostic
BIOPSY VARIANTS (Columbia classification):
- Tip lesion — best prognosis
- NOS (not otherwise specified) — most common
- Perihilar — typical of secondary forms
- Cellular — often primary
- Collapsing — worst prognosis (HIV, APOL1, parvovirus)

Treatment by type
Primary FSGS
- High-dose prednisolone 1 mg/kg (max 60-80 mg) daily for 12-16 weeks
- Then slow taper over 6 months
- If steroid-resistant or relapsing: tacrolimus or ciclosporin for 6-12 months
- Refractory: rituximab, MMF
- Add SPARSENTAN (NICE-approved 2024) for persistent proteinuria
Genetic FSGS
- Avoid immunosuppression (doesn't work, harms)
- Maximal ACE/ARB + SGLT2 inhibitor + sparsentan
- Genetic counselling, family screening
- Plan for transplant — low recurrence risk
Secondary FSGS
- TREAT THE CAUSE:
- Obesity: weight loss (GLP-1, bariatric surgery)
- HIV: HAART — often dramatic improvement
- Reflux: urological assessment
- Drug-induced: stop the drug
- Maximal ACE/ARB + SGLT2 inhibitor
- Avoid immunosuppression
ALL FSGS — SUPPORTIVE:
- ACE inhibitor or ARB to maximum tolerated dose
- SGLT2 inhibitor (dapagliflozin)
- Salt restriction < 5 g/day
- Statin (high cholesterol)
- Anticoagulation if albumin < 20 g/L and very high proteinuria (clot risk)
- Vitamin D (lost in urine)
- Pneumovax if heavy proteinuria
Prognosis and transplant
Prognosis Depends Heavily On Response
- Complete remission (urine ACR < 30): 10-year kidney survival > 90%
- Partial remission (50% reduction, ACR < 300): 10-year survival ~70%
- No remission: 10-year survival 30-50%
Factors Predicting Worse Outcome
- Heavy proteinuria > 10 g/day
- Reduced eGFR at diagnosis
- Collapsing variant
- Tubular atrophy/interstitial fibrosis on biopsy
- APOL1 high-risk genotype
- African ancestry
- Steroid resistance
Kidney Transplant
- Primary FSGS recurs in 30-40% of grafts — usually within days/weeks
- Recurrence rate even higher in second transplant if first was lost to recurrence
- Pre-emptive plasma exchange + rituximab may reduce recurrence
- Genetic FSGS rarely recurs (< 5%)
- Secondary FSGS rarely recurs
- Living donor decisions need careful genetic and risk discussion
Living with FSGS
Daily
- Take medications consistently
- Monitor weight, BP daily during active disease
- Low salt cooking — < 5 g/day
- Moderate protein 0.8 g/kg/day
- Avoid NSAIDs (worsen proteinuria)
Flag To Your Team
- Sudden weight gain > 2 kg in a few days
- New or worsening leg swelling
- Frothy urine returning after remission
- Calf pain or chest pain (clot risk in nephrotic syndrome)
- Severe infection (immunosuppression)
Long-term
- Annual flu, COVID, 5-yearly pneumococcal vaccines
- Bone protection if long steroids
- Cardiovascular risk factor optimisation
- Mental health support — nephrotic syndrome is debilitating
- Pregnancy planning with team — usually possible in remission
